I would be curious where the VNC password for ARD is even stored.
That one's easy (since I was just looking for it last week).
/Library/Preferences/com.apple.VNCSettings.txt
Note it's readable by root/wheel only.
If you read the Kickstart script included with ARD, it shows this
file and what permissions it sets on it when modifying that password.
It also indicates you must first encrypt the password before having
Kickstart apply it as Kickstart will only pass your input directly to
the file (does not encrypt). So, if you used Kickstart to pass the
phrase "mypass" to it, the text file would show, in plain text, the
same phrase instead of the encrypted one.
